The Role of the Interstate Medical Licensure Compact (IMLC)
The most considerable factor to the "instant" licensing motion is the Interstate Medical Licensure Compact (IMLC). The IMLC is a contract among taking part U.S. states and territories to work together to substantially simplify the licensing procedure for physicians who wish to practice in multiple states.

Under this compact, a physician can obtain a Letter of Qualification (LOQ) from their state of primary licensure. Once this letter is provided, the physician can "purchase" or request licenses from any other member state almost instantly.

Is it legal to "purchase" a medical license?
It is legal to pay administrative costs for expedited processing through official state boards or the IMLC. However, it is extremely prohibited to purchase a deceptive license or medical diploma from a non-accredited source.
2. How fast can I in fact get a license through the IMLC?
When the Letter of Qualification is provided (which takes 2-- 4 weeks), additional state licenses can typically be approved within 3 to 5 business days.
3. Do all states take part in expedited licensing?
A lot of states have some form of expedited path for "clean" applications, but just those in the IMLC (currently over 35 states and areas) offer the true expedited multi-state process.
4. What is the distinction in between a "Temporary License" and an "Expedited License"?
A short-term license is generally provided throughout public health emergency situations or for specific short-term roles and may expire rapidly. An expedited license is a full, irreversible medical license issued through a quicker administrative procedure.
5. Does an expedited license have restricted benefits?
No. An expedited license given through the IMLC or a state's fast-track program carries the very same weight, rights, and duties as a license acquired through the conventional route.
